The Moro reflex is a term commonly associated with newborns. It is a primitive, innate reflex that is present even during prenatal development. This reflex typically disappears between 4 to 6 months of age. The intensity of the Moro reflex varies from child to child.
It is one of the most common causes of waking and short sleep in newborns.
How the Moro Reflex Manifests
If you have a newborn at home, you might notice moments when your baby, lying on their back, suddenly jerks their arms out. The fingers spread apart, and there is a slight extension of the neck and spine. The baby then retracts the arms, often followed by a loud cry.
This reflex can occur when the baby feels like they are falling, such as when being lifted. However, the baby doesn’t need to actually be falling; the reflex is a response to a sudden stimulus. This can be auditory (a loud unexpected noise), visual (bright light), or tactile (touch). The baby also reacts similarly to a loss of balance.
The Moro reflex is instinctive, as if the baby is trying to grasp onto the mother’s body. In reality, it represents a protective motor reaction to a sudden disturbance of bodily equilibrium or extreme sudden stimulation (1) . In premature babies, the reflex is less intense than in full-term newborns (2).
Moro Reflex and Sleep
The Moro reflex is often the reason why newborns wake up 10-15 minutes after falling asleep. They wake up due to the jerking motion of their arms. As mentioned earlier, babies develop this reflex during prenatal development. Even in the womb, the baby involuntarily “throws” their arms out. However, in the womb, the baby does not have as much space, and the uterus restricts the arm movements. After birth, the baby suddenly has more space, which is why they wake up from the jerking motion during sleep.
